North Carolina White Alone Female or Women Population By County in 2023

Updated on July 3, 2025.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2023, the White Alone female population in North Carolina was 3,825,385 and represented 69.06% of the total North Carolina female population (5,538,969).

Among North Carolina counties, Wake County had the highest White Alone female population (397,448), followed by Mecklenburg County (332,488), and Guilford County (154,086).
